#9c6a6e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c6a6e is composed of 61.2% red, 41.6%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.1% magenta, 29.5%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 355.2 degrees, a saturation of 20.2% and a lightness of 51.4%. #9c6a6e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d4dc with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#9c6a6e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9c6a6e has RGB values of R:156, G:106,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.29,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10250862.

Shades and Tints of #9c6a6e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040303 is the darkest color, while #faf7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c6a6e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897d7e is the less saturated color, while #fb0b1e is the most saturated one.
